"Shell In A Box is project that includes a web server,
Javascript files and CSS templates to setup web-based terminal
access to your system. You might remember that Shell In A Box was
part of last week's TurnKey Linux project. It is a fascinating
project of its own and it deserves some focused attention.
"Give yourself the freedom of a web-based terminal session with
Shell In A Box. It's a small, easy to install and use application
that makes downloading an SSH client obsolete. And, if your system
has SSL/TLS enabled, your communications are secure."
